Subject: Margin Review — Quick Heads-Up

Hi all,

Before the board pack lands: gross margin on the Brellux range came in at 44%, a touch under target. Nothing alarming, mostly shipping costs out of the Hartvale depot. Deck goes out Wednesday. Happy to walk anyone through it beforehand. The confidential note below previews our plan.

board note of yajog-bahop: The steering committee signed off on a budget of $236.5 million for Project Raleth.

Ticket: the Brindlecap vault holding our event schema registry credentials locked itself again after the rotation job misfired. Producers can still publish, but nobody can register new event schemas until it's reopened. Future maintainers, don't re-rotate — just unlock and rerun the job. Unlock the vault using the recovery passphrase right below this line.

unlock words, hahip-yagef: zorok-novmir-zorix-silax

## Environments — Webhook Retry Semantics

Quillpost delivers webhooks with exponential backoff across all three environments; only the retry ceiling differs. Failed deliveries in staging are dropped after the final attempt, while production dead-letters them for replay. The per-environment retry settings currently in effect are shown below.

service settings:
[oliix]
team = noveth
access_code = ac_4de949
host = oliix.novachq.corp
port = 8080
owner = wenir.casion
peer = wenys.lumicstack.corp

Minutes — Management Meeting, Joint Venture Proposal

Present: full management team. We walked through the proposed JV between Halloway Craft and Ternbridge Marine. Most folks like the 60/40 split; legal still fussing over IP carve-outs. Agreed to form a small working group and report back in three weeks. Board gets the full pack then. The confidential commercial angle is noted below.

board note of bawep-tajef: Queniusek Systems plans to raise the Quenvan list price by 53.1 percent in March. The pricing group signed off on a budget of $176.4 million for Project Drueth. The renewal with Casionix Partners closes at $142.5 million a year, 8.3 percent below the last contract. Project Fraax slips by six weeks because of the tooling delay.